With his chattering Bo tells you to keep your distance; heobviously doesn't like being held. Perhaps you can work you way around it with encouragement and little treats?

Yeah, he gets cucumber when I hold him, but he eats really fast! And when it's all finished he starts chattering again (but it's not loud). Do I always have to feed him or will he learn to like being cuddled without the cucumber?
 
You can give him the slowly cucumber in tiny bits, while he is sitting on your lap. Touch him only "by accident", but talk to him a lot. With patience, you can get him to let you touch you and cuddle you.

It took me months with my Minx, but when I broke the barrier, it didn't matter if I gave her a pet in the middle of her running free in the garden!

If something doesn't work, go back a step and give it a fresh start - persistence is the key!
